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.10.02;
Скачать: CL | DM;

Вниз

Время обработки   Найти похожие ветки 

 
drakulita ©   (2003-09-19 09:56) [0]

Прога обрабатывает два текстовых файла размерами от 15 метров первый и от 30 метров второй. Работает два цикла
while not eof(f1) do begin
if (усл.1)and(усл.2) ... then begin
......
end else begin
repiat
if (усл.1)and(усл.2) ... then begin
......
end else begin
.....
until eof(f2) and .....
end;
end;
на работу програмы уходит больше 1 часа хотелось бы уменьшить до минут. Задача порезать два исходных файла по организациям не терея структур строк. Я решил выдергивать строку и ложить в новый файл удаляя из исходного. Этим добился уменьшения на 20 минут.
Зарание спасибо!!!


 
panov ©   (2003-09-19 09:59) [1]

Одно из простых решений - загрузить оба файла в БД. Обработка сократится до нескольких минут.


 
Брат ©   (2003-09-19 10:00) [2]

Проц поменяй :)


 
drakulita ©   (2003-09-19 10:00) [3]

Теряется структура строки


 
MBo ©   (2003-09-19 10:06) [4]

Непонятна задача - при чем тут два файла? Надо бы уточнить.



Страницы: 1 вся ветка

Текущий архив: 2003.10.02;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.023 c
1-3974
dataMaster
2003-09-19 10:53
2003.10.02
Как (или где) поймать изменение вводимых Items


3-3796
Шурик Ш
2003-09-11 10:44
2003.10.02
Восстановление DBF-ника по индексу.


1-3915
Игорь Ч
2003-09-22 09:31
2003.10.02
Как организовать взаимодействие между программами?


1-3926
Seldon
2003-09-21 11:32
2003.10.02
FileExists( A: 1.txt )


3-3785
Samgin
2003-09-11 12:54
2003.10.02
Record already locked by this session